Output a8faf9ae9365f307e29acdeaa1a88583de2b243ae87f36b04bc981c58b830d04:2

value
131343007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d02c3e4f65b3a98e5e1c6287486b6b6785c043 OP_EQUAL
address
37biYvTEcBVMoR1NGkPTGvHUuLTrzcLpiv
transaction
a8faf9ae9365f307e29acdeaa1a88583de2b243ae87f36b04bc981c58b830d04
confirmations
162535
spent
true